Good news: buses, ferries, trains and flights can carry you and your bike from Sicamous to Pender Island.
For scale
As the crow flies384 km
Biking whole way552 km Β· 35 h 40 m
By car540 km Β· 6 h 47 m
We found five ways to get you there, ferries doing the heavy lifting.
π Riding a coach? Most BC coach operators want your bike bagged or boxed. Our field note walks through packing it, including an inexpensive packable bike bag we like: How to bike-and-bus in BC ›
Note: Most carriers carry only a handful of bikes, and summer weekends fill up fast. Reserve where you can. Where you can't, go early or have a backup plan.
Option one · four legs
SkyTrain helps connect the dots.
CarrierRideYour bike
πEbusVancouver β Calgary (Hwy 1)or Rider Express (Vancouver β Calgary)Sicamous βPacific Central Station (Vancouver)418 kmRides in the hold β bagged or cloth-wrapped (no plastic), or boxed$30 per bike
Runs the same Highway 1 corridor as Rider Express, so compare schedules and fares.
πSkyTrainTransLinkPacific Central Station (Vancouver) βBridgeport (Richmond)Roll on, free β 2 bikes per carAvoid rush hourE-bikes OK
πTransLink620 Bridgeport Station / Tsawwassen Ferryor the 900 Bike Bus (seasonal)Bridgeport (Richmond) βTsawwassen (Delta)22 kmRack on the bus, free2 bikes β first come, first servedE-bikes OK
The 620 is year-round, roughly hourly, timed to sailings, with two bike-rack spots. On busy summer ferry days the seasonal 900 Bike Bus can carry an extra 10 bikes.
β΄οΈBC FerriesTsawwassen β Southern Gulf IslandsTsawwassen (Delta) βOtter Bay (Pender Island)27 kmRoll on, free β no reservation neededE-bikes OK β no charging on board
Sailing times vary a lot by routing: some trips are about 50 minutes, others run 2 to 3 hours via Swartz Bay. Check the specific sailing before you book.
π²You arrive at Otter Bay (Pender Island).
